Book Now: Village Family Motor Inn

  • Home
    Properties:
  • >
  • World
    5,773,255
  • >
  • Australia Hotels
    86,949
  • >
  • Tasmania State Hotels
    3,062
  • >
  • Launceston Hotels
    235
  • >
  • Village Family Motor Inn